As the firmware evolved, it gained more sophisticated boot methods. The "Dev1" and "Dev3" modes allowed users to boot .ELF files (homebrew executables) directly from the USB memory card and other storage devices. This gave Memento similar functions to high-end modchips like the DMS4 or Crystal, allowing users to run homebrew applications and eventually unpatched ISO files.
